Saturday (24/2) around 30 Honda BRV filled the parking spot at Building 17 kawasan industri PT Multistrada Arah Sarana Tbk, Cikarang. Around 60 members of BRV Community of Bekasi Chapter or better known as Indonesia Braver Community happily doing factory visit to Cikarang tire plant to watch tire manufacturing process.

Sitting on the land of 120 hectare, these 60 participants were taken to directly look at the tire manufacturing process, starting from compound up to ready made products, ready to be shipped to overseas and domestic distributors. The tire is manufactured with the latest technology based on international acceptable standard.

This Factory Visit occurred in Lemah Abang Industrial Park, Cikarang, Bekasi, and took place from 09.00 to 13.00 WIB. The community members not only had a chance to look directly into production process, but also receiving knowledge on the products of PT Multistrada and sharing session tips on how to look after the tire.

On the sharing session, the TS Team of PT Multistrada Arah Sarana Tbk presented material about public perception on good tire. According to the presenter, the stigma of good tire usually refers to one brand. This must be corrected since good tire is the one that is looked after. “Many of us still think that durable tires are the one from Brand A or B or C, although the truth is the good tire is the tire that is being looked after. How we care about tire pressure, balancing, and spooring will impact on the durability and security of tire as well riving comfort” said Iwan as TS Team of PT MSA.

This lively session attracted many questions from the community members. Most of the questions is about the interval needed to do spooring. Iwan explained that spooring is ideally done every 6 months, but if felt uncomfortable, it is better to check directly to the workshop.

Next question was about when to replace the tire based on TWI (Tread Wear Indication) in the form of lumps as a sign of worn tire. Iwan said, “Please be careful when buying secondhand tire, you need to pay attention to this TWI since it will affect the safety factor more”.
